Hi Bill, 

 

Ian and moi took a trip to the Thredbo  River at Jindabyne this morning where I managed to land this nice  52 cm  (3lb 4  0zs dressed Rainbow Trout. on a nymph floated below a  parachute adams. Also caught a 10>% inch brown trout and dropped another nice trout on a adams in the same hole that the pictured rainbow was caught. Seen some nice trout as we wandered down the river but they were very spooky in the clear water  which is running  reasonably well  Not much surface action except in a couple of spots near the elms and most fish spotted were down deep.
